#site{margin-right:calc(-1*(100vw - 100%))}.page-width{max-width:96vw;margin:0 auto;padding:0}.xs{display:none!important}.md{display:block!important}.md.inline{display:inline-block!important}.md.flex{display:flex!important}.colgrid>.md-nmb,.md-nmb{margin-bottom:0!important}.break{position:relative;display:table;width:100vw;left:50%;margin:0}.break>.wrap{position:relative;margin:0 auto;left:-50%}.colgridxs,.colgrid,ul.colgrid{display:flex!important;flex-wrap:wrap;margin-left:-10px!important;margin-right:-10px!important}.colgridxs.hide,.colgrid.hide,ul.colgrid.hide{display:none!important}.colgridxs>li,.colgrid>li,ul.colgrid>li,.colgridxs>div,.colgrid>div,ul.colgrid>div{position:relative;display:flex;flex-direction:column;width:100%;padding:0 10px}.colgridxs>li.hide,.colgrid>li.hide,ul.colgrid>li.hide,.colgridxs>div.hide,.colgrid>div.hide,ul.colgrid>div.hide{display:none!important}.colgridxs>li.padr,.colgrid>li.padr,ul.colgrid>li.padr,.colgridxs>div.padr,.colgrid>div.padr,ul.colgrid>div.padr{padding-right:20px}.colgridxs>li.padl,.colgrid>li.padl,ul.colgrid>li.padl,.colgridxs>div.padl,.colgrid>div.padl,ul.colgrid>div.padl{padding-left:20px}.colgridxs>li.padrw,.colgrid>li.padrw,ul.colgrid>li.padrw,.colgridxs>div.padrw,.colgrid>div.padrw,ul.colgrid>div.padrw{padding-right:40px}.colgridxs>li.padlw,.colgrid>li.padlw,ul.colgrid>li.padlw,.colgridxs>div.padlw,.colgrid>div.padlw,ul.colgrid>div.padlw{padding-left:40px}.colgridxs>.md-one-sixth,.colgrid>.md-one-sixth,ul.colgrid>.md-one-sixth{width:16.666666667%}.colgridxs>.md-one-fifth,.colgrid>.md-one-fifth,ul.colgrid>.md-one-fifth{width:20%}.colgridxs>.md-one-eighth,.colgrid>.md-one-eighth,ul.colgrid>.md-one-eighth{width:12.5%}.colgridxs>.md-one-tenth,.colgrid>.md-one-tenth,ul.colgrid>.md-one-tenth{width:10%}.colgridxs>.md-quarter,.colgrid>.md-quarter,ul.colgrid>.md-quarter{width:25%}.colgridxs>.md-three-quarters,.colgrid>.md-three-quarters,ul.colgrid>.md-three-quarters{width:75%}.colgridxs>.md-third,.colgrid>.md-third,ul.colgrid>.md-third{width:33.3%}.colgridxs>.md-two-thirds,.colgrid>.md-two-thirds,ul.colgrid>.md-two-thirds{width:66.6%}.colgridxs>.md-two-fifths,.colgrid>.md-two-fifths,ul.colgrid>.md-two-fifths{width:40%}.colgridxs>.md-three-fifths,.colgrid>.md-three-fifths,ul.colgrid>.md-three-fifths{width:60%}.colgridxs>.md-four-fifths,.colgrid>.md-four-fifths,ul.colgrid>.md-four-fifths{width:80%}.colgridxs>.md-half,.colgrid>.md-half,ul.colgrid>.md-half{width:50%}.colgridxs>.md-full,.colgrid>.md-full,ul.colgrid>.md-full{width:100%}.colgridxs>.push-half,.colgrid>.push-half,ul.colgrid>.push-half{left:50%}.colgridxs>.pull-half,.colgrid>.pull-half,ul.colgrid>.pull-half{right:50%}.colgridxs>.push-one-tenth,.colgrid>.push-one-tenth,ul.colgrid>.push-one-tenth{left:10%}.colgridxs>.pull-one-tenth,.colgrid>.pull-one-tenth,ul.colgrid>.pull-one-tenth{right:10%}.colgridxs>.push-one-fifth,.colgrid>.push-one-fifth,ul.colgrid>.push-one-fifth{left:20%}.colgridxs>.push-one-fifth,.colgrid>.push-one-fifth,ul.colgrid>.push-one-fifth{left:20%}.colgridxs>.push-one-sixth,.colgrid>.push-one-sixth,ul.colgrid>.push-one-sixth{left:16.666666667%}.colgridxs>.push-two-fifths,.colgrid>.push-two-fifths,ul.colgrid>.push-two-fifths{left:40%}.colgridxs>.push-three-fifths,.colgrid>.push-three-fifths,ul.colgrid>.push-three-fifths{left:60%}.colgridxs>.push-one-third,.colgrid>.push-one-third,ul.colgrid>.push-one-third{left:33.3%}.colgridxs>.push-two-thirds,.colgrid>.push-two-thirds,ul.colgrid>.push-two-thirds{left:66.6%}.colgridxs>.push-one-quarter,.colgrid>.push-one-quarter,ul.colgrid>.push-one-quarter{left:25%}.colgridxs>.push-one-eighth,.colgrid>.push-one-eighth,ul.colgrid>.push-one-eighth{left:12.5%}.colgridxs>.push-three-quarters,.colgrid>.push-three-quarters,ul.colgrid>.push-three-quarters{left:75%}.colgridxs>.pull-one-quarter,.colgrid>.pull-one-quarter,ul.colgrid>.pull-one-quarter{right:25%}.colgridxs>.pull-one-third,.colgrid>.pull-one-third,ul.colgrid>.pull-one-third{right:33.3%}.colgridxs>.pull-two-thirds,.colgrid>.pull-two-thirds,ul.colgrid>.pull-two-thirds{right:66.6%}.colgridxs>.pull-two-fifths,.colgrid>.pull-two-fifths,ul.colgrid>.pull-two-fifths{right:40%}.colgridxs>.pull-four-fifths,.colgrid>.pull-four-fifths,ul.colgrid>.pull-four-fifths{right:80%}.colgridxs>.pull-three-quarters,.colgrid>.pull-three-quarters,ul.colgrid>.pull-three-quarters{right:75%}#head>nav>label,#head>nav>a{display:block;width:35px;height:0;padding-bottom:35px;margin:0 15px 0 5px!important}#head #logo{flex:0 0 194.3px}#head .search-form input{font-size:16px;height:35px;width:100%}#nav{flex:1 0 33%}#nav>ul{display:none!important}#promo-banner .promo-counter{display:inline-block;margin-left:.25em}#promo-banner .promo-counter strong{margin-right:.25em}#foot .col ul,.mce-footer ul{line-height:1.8}.sidebar>div{width:400px;max-width:80vw}.accordianxs{background:none}.accordianxs section>:first-child{display:none}.accordianxs section>:last-child{-webkit-transition:all .6s ease-in-out;-o-transition:all .6s ease-in-out;transition:all .6s ease-in-out;visibility:visible;max-height:10000px}.accordianxs section>:last-child>div{padding:0}.products .t{margin-bottom:40px}.products .t strong{font-size:20px}#filters .option{position:relative;display:flex;flex-direction:column;flex:0}#filters .option>label{padding:0 40px;position:relative}#filters .option>label ins{width:40px;display:inline-block}#filters .option>label:after{-webkit-transform:translate(0,1px);-ms-transform:translate(0,1px);-o-transform:translate(0,1px);transform:translate(0,1px);width:30px;height:40px;position:absolute;background:url("https://cdn.jarrolds.co.uk/ui/chevron.svg") no-repeat center center;background-size:28px;top:0;right:40px;content:""}#filters .option input{display:none}#filters .option input:checked+label{font-weight:600}#filters .option input:checked+label:after{background:url("https://cdn.jarrolds.co.uk/ui/close.svg") no-repeat center center;background-size:20px}#filters .option input:checked~div[titan-facet-group]{display:block}#filters .option div[titan-facet-group]{-webkit-transform:translate(-50%,0);-ms-transform:translate(-50%,0);-o-transform:translate(-50%,0);transform:translate(-50%,0);display:none;position:absolute;top:40px;left:50%;background:#f5f5f5;border:2px solid #f5f5f5;min-width:300px;z-index:1001;text-align:left}#filters .option div[titan-facet-group] header{background:#fff;padding:10px;display:flex;flex-wrap:wrap}#filters .option div[titan-facet-group] header ins{font-style:normal;line-height:30px;font-size:14px;text-decoration:none;flex:1}#filters .option div[titan-facet-group] header .button{flex:0;margin-left:5px}#filters .option .drop{padding:0 10px;max-height:308px;overflow-x:hidden;overflow-y:auto}#filters .option .drop::-webkit-scrollbar{border-radius:.5em;background-color:#f5f5f5;width:16px}#filters .option .drop::-webkit-scrollbar-track{border-radius:.5em;background-color:#f5f5f5}#filters .option .drop::-webkit-scrollbar-track:hover{background-color:transparent}#filters .option .drop::-webkit-scrollbar-thumb{border-radius:.5em;background-color:#4d4d4d;border-radius:16px;border:5px solid #f5f5f5}#filters .option .drop::-webkit-scrollbar-thumb:hover{background-color:#babac0;border:4px solid #f4f4f4}#filters .option .drop::-webkit-scrollbar-button{display:none}#filters .option .drop>span,#filters .option .drop>div>span{cursor:pointer;display:block;white-space:nowrap;line-height:40px;margin:10px 0;background:#fff;padding:0 10px}#filters .option .drop>span.on,#filters .option .drop>div>span.on{color:#fff;background:#000}#pdp{margin:0 0 40px 0}#pdp>.colgrid:first-child{margin-bottom:40px}#pdp .detail{text-align:left}#pdp .pricing{margin:30px 0;font-size:14px}#pdp .pricing .now,#pdp .pricing .rrp{font-size:24px}#pdp .buynow{margin-bottom:30px}#pdp #paypal-credit{height:24px}#pdp .panel,#pdp .accordianxs{margin-bottom:40px}#pdp .panel .colgrid.space .md-half:first-child,#pdp .accordianxs .colgrid.space .md-half:first-child,#pdp .panel .colgrid.space .md-third:first-child,#pdp .accordianxs .colgrid.space .md-third:first-child,#pdp .panel .colgrid.space .md-quarter:first-child,#pdp .accordianxs .colgrid.space .md-quarter:first-child{padding-right:30px}#pdp .panel .colgrid.space .md-half:last-child,#pdp .accordianxs .colgrid.space .md-half:last-child,#pdp .panel .colgrid.space .md-third:last-child,#pdp .accordianxs .colgrid.space .md-third:last-child,#pdp .panel .colgrid.space .md-quarter:last-child,#pdp .accordianxs .colgrid.space .md-quarter:last-child{padding-left:30px}#pdp .panel{margin:40px 0}#pdp .panel.grey .wrap{padding:40px 0}#variants .builder .group{margin-bottom:15px}#variants .builder .group .scroll{max-height:260px}#variants .builder .group .options>div.swd{flex:0 0 11.111111111%}#qtyinput{max-width:100%;margin:0;flex-wrap:wrap}#qtyinput>label:first-child{padding-left:0;line-height:1;flex:0 0 100%}#pdp-nav{display:flex;flex-wrap:nowrap;justify-content:center;margin:40px 0;border-bottom:1px solid #000}#pdp-nav a{flex:0 1 auto;margin:0 40px;font-family:'DM Sans',serif;font-weight:600;font-size:20px;padding-bottom:20px}.supplier-cart .quantity{padding:0}.dv-basic,.dv-header-text,.dv-contact-form,.dv-samples-form,#checkout-wrap.order-confirm{max-width:865px;margin-left:auto;margin-right:auto}article>div[data-titan-area]:first-child>.dv-con:first-child,article>.dv-con:first-child,article .dv-con-first{margin-top:40px}article>div[data-titan-area]:first-child>.dv-con:first-child.dv-header-text,article>.dv-con:first-child.dv-header-text,article .dv-con-first.dv-header-text,article>div[data-titan-area]:first-child>.dv-con:first-child.dv-header-image,article>.dv-con:first-child.dv-header-image,article .dv-con-first.dv-header-image{margin-top:0}article>div[data-titan-area]:first-child>.dv-con:first-child.dv-header-text .carousel,article>.dv-con:first-child.dv-header-text .carousel,article .dv-con-first.dv-header-text .carousel,article>div[data-titan-area]:first-child>.dv-con:first-child.dv-header-image .carousel,article>.dv-con:first-child.dv-header-image .carousel,article .dv-con-first.dv-header-image .carousel{padding-top:10px}article>div[data-titan-area]:first-child>.dv-con:first-child.dv-header-text,article>.dv-con:first-child.dv-header-text,article .dv-con-first.dv-header-text{margin-bottom:20px}.dv-block .square{display:block;width:100%;height:0;padding-bottom:50%}.dv-block .p{text-align:right}.dv-block .colgridxs .small{margin-bottom:20px}.dv-block.image-2x1 .square,.dv-block.image-2p2 .square,.dv-block.image-1p4 .square,.dv-block.image-1pt .square{padding-bottom:102.345%}.dv-block.image-2x1 .md-two-thirds .square,.dv-block.image-2p2 .md-two-thirds .square,.dv-block.image-1p4 .md-two-thirds .square,.dv-block.image-1pt .md-two-thirds .square{padding-bottom:76.243%}.dv-block.image-2x1 .md-third .square,.dv-block.image-2p2 .md-third .square,.dv-block.image-1p4 .md-third .square,.dv-block.image-1pt .md-third .square{padding-bottom:156.124%}.dv-block.image-2x1 .md-third .small .square,.dv-block.image-2p2 .md-third .small .square,.dv-block.image-1p4 .md-third .small .square,.dv-block.image-1pt .md-third .small .square{padding-bottom:68.75%;background-size:cover!important}.dv-block.image-2x1 .md-half .small .square,.dv-block.image-2p2 .md-half .small .square,.dv-block.image-1p4 .md-half .small .square,.dv-block.image-1pt .md-half .small .square{padding-bottom:97.21%}.dv-block.image-1pt .md-half:last-child,.dv-block.image-1ptb .md-half:last-child{padding:0 20px}.dv-block.image-1ptb.grey .wrap{padding:40px 0}.dv-block.image-1ptb .square{padding-bottom:55.47%}.dv-block.our-picks.grey .wrap{padding:40px 0}.dv-block.our-picks .page-width{position:relative}.dv-articles.related .core,.dv-articles.featured .core{align-items:center}.dv-articles.related .core h4,.dv-articles.featured .core h4,.dv-articles.related .core .parent,.dv-articles.featured .core .parent,.dv-articles.related .core .p,.dv-articles.featured .core .p{text-align:center}.dv-articles.related .wrap,.dv-articles.featured .wrap{margin-top:40px;padding:40px 0}.dv-articles.related .wrap .page-width,.dv-articles.featured .wrap .page-width{position:relative}.dv-articles.related .wrap h3,.dv-articles.featured .wrap h3{-webkit-transform:translate(-50%,0);-ms-transform:translate(-50%,0);-o-transform:translate(-50%,0);transform:translate(-50%,0);position:absolute;top:80px;left:-20px;margin:0;z-index:10;line-height:1}.dv-articles.related .wrap h3 span,.dv-articles.featured .wrap h3 span{display:block;-webkit-transform:rotate(270deg);-ms-transform:rotate(270deg);-o-transform:rotate(270deg);transform:rotate(270deg);-webkit-transform-origin:bottom;-moz-transform-origin:bottom;-ms-transform-origin:bottom;transform-origin:bottom}.dv-articles.featured+.dv-articles.browse{margin-top:80px}#toggle-articles:checked+.colgrid .h{display:flex}